Michael Kuka
Known For
Loco Love
Movie | 2003
Can't Stop Dancing
Movie | 1999
All Credits
Movie Credits
TV Credits
Loco Love
Movie | 2003
Norm
Can't Stop Dancing
Movie | 1999
Good Dancer
Loco Love
Movie | 2003
Norm
Can't Stop Dancing
Movie | 1999
Good Dancer